Custom UI Development: Design and develop custom, scalable, and maintainable front-end components using Lightning Web Components (LWC).
State Management: Implement complex client-side logic and state management within Salesforce.
API Integration: Connect front-end components to Salesforce data via Wire Service and Apex controllers, as well as integrating third-party REST/SOAP APIs.
Design System Alignment: Ensure all UI elements adhere to the Salesforce Lightning Design System (SLDS) while extending it for unique brand requirements.
Performance Optimization: Optimize component load times and rendering performance within the Salesforce container.
Mobile Responsiveness: Ensure all custom interfaces are fully responsive and functional on the Salesforce Mobile App.
Design Implementation: Translate high-fidelity Figma/Sketch mockups into pixel-perfect Salesforce interfaces.
Usability Advocacy: Apply UX principles (accessibility, hierarchy, affordance) to ensure that the technical solutions developed are intuitive for the end-user.
Prototyping: Rapidly develop "living prototypes" within a sandbox environment to test user interactions and layouts.
Accessibility (a11y): Ensure all developed components meet WCAG standards and provide a consistent experience for users with disabilities.
Requirements
5+ Years in Web Development: Deep focus on modern front-end frameworks (React, Vue, or Angular experience is a plus).
3+ Years in Salesforce Development: Specialized experience building custom UI solutions using LWC (Lightning Web Components).
Portfolio/Examples: Ability to demonstrate previous work where technical complexity was balanced with high-quality visual design.
Languages: Expert-level JavaScript (ES6+), CSS3 (including Flexbox and Grid), and HTML5.
Design Literacy: Proficiency in navigating Figma or Adobe XD to inspect layers, styles, and assets.
DevOps: Experience with Git-based version control and automated deployment pipelines (CI/CD).
Styling: Deep understanding of SLDS (Salesforce Lightning Design System) and CSS preprocessors like SASS/LESS.
Testing: Experience writing unit tests for front-end components (e.g., Jest).
Platform Limits: Knowledge of Salesforce Governor Limits and how they impact front-end performance and data fetching.
Required: Salesforce Certified JavaScript Developer I.
Required: Salesforce Certified User Experience (UX) Designer.
Preferred: Salesforce Certified Platform Developer I (PDI).
Tech Stack
Angular
Cloud
JavaScript
Jest
React
SCSS
SOAP
Vue.js
Benefits
Health & Wellness: Health care coverage designed for the mind and body.
Flexible Downtime: Generous time off helps keep you energized for your time on.
Continuous Learning: Access a wealth of resources to grow your career and learn valuable new skills.
Invest in Your Future: Secure your financial future through competitive pay, retirement planning, a continuing education program with a company-matched student loan contribution, and financial wellness programs.
Family Friendly Perks: It’s not just about you. S&P Global has perks for your partners and little ones, too, with some best-in class benefits for families.
Beyond the Basics: From retail discounts to referral incentive awards—small perks can make a big difference.